1. Eric Lilljequist and Dean Adrien will take the stage tonight at Amazing Things Arts Center tonight at 8. According to the website, "at 24 Eric was involved in the now classic Boston band, Orphan, along with fellow guitarist and harmonizer, Dean Adrien and Jonathan Edwards, who later penned Sunshine Go Away Today and went on to national stardom. Lilljequist's songwriting took off and their first album was entirely his own works." Uploaded to this column, is a video of a song off their latest CD.

2. Flags will fly at half staff from sunrise until sunset today, Aug. 31 in honor of Astronaut Neil Armstrong, who died Aug. 25, 2012 in accordance with President Barack Obama's proclamation.
